Chapter 7: Reducing risk, strengthening resilience: Social protection and nutrition [Nourishing Millions]
IN THE MID-1990S, governments and researchers in three countries from very different parts of the world—Bangladesh, Brazil, and Mexico— began moving toward a new type of poverty alleviation program.
